What was Wigan Athletic's wage bill in 2017/18?
Wigan Athletic paid £165,750 a week in 2017/18 - £8,619,000 across the year - spread over a squad of 53. We hold a wage for all 53 players in that squad.
Who was the highest paid Wigan Athletic player in 2017/18?
Nick Powell was the highest earner in the 2017/18 squad on £15,000 a week, 2.6x the 22+ squad average of £5,800.
What was the average Wigan Athletic salary in 2017/18?
The average Wigan Athletic player aged 22 or over earned £5,800 a week in 2017/18, across the 26 we hold a wage for, against a squad of 53. The top five earners took 30% of the bill between them.
How do Wigan Athletic's 2017/18 wages compare with now?
Wigan Athletic pay £82,784 a week in 2026/27, 50% lower than the £165,750 of 2017/18. The current squad is 61 players against 53 then.
